Official title

A Phase Ib/II, Multi-center, Open-label Study of INC280 in Combination With Buparlisib in Patients With Recurrent Glioblastoma

Study identification

NCT ID
NCT01870726
Recruitment status
Terminated
Study type
Interventional
Phase
Phase 1, Phase 2
Lead sponsor
Novartis Pharmaceuticals
Industry
Enrollment
43 participants
